How to Fill Out Creating a Data Documentation:
01
Start by gathering all relevant information and data sources that need to be documented. This includes any databases, spreadsheets, software systems, or other sources where data is stored.
02
Create a clear and organized structure for your data documentation. This can be done using a template or creating your own format. Include sections for data sources, data definitions, data quality standards, data transformations, and any other relevant information.
03
Begin filling out the data documentation by providing detailed descriptions for each data source. Include important details such as the purpose of the data source, the type of data it contains, how it is collected or generated, and any specific limitations or considerations.
04
Define each data element or field within the data sources. This involves providing a clear description, specifying the data type, and identifying any restrictions or validations that apply.
05
Document any data quality standards or rules that need to be followed. This can include guidelines for ensuring data accuracy, completeness, consistency, and integrity. Include any specific data validation checks or processes that should be performed.
06
Document any data transformations or calculations that occur within the data sources. Include clear explanations of how the transformations are applied, any formulas or algorithms used, and the purpose or impact of the transformations on the data.
07
Include any additional documentation or references that may be necessary, such as data dictionaries, diagrams, or code samples. This can help users understand the data sources and make better use of the documented information.
Who Needs Creating a Data Documentation:
01
Data Analysts: Data analysts rely on data documentation to understand the various data sources and effectively analyze the data. They need detailed information about the data structure, definitions, and any transformations or calculations applied.
02
Data Scientists: Data scientists use data documentation to build models and perform advanced analytics. They need clear insights into the data sources, data quality standards, and any specific considerations or limitations that may impact their analysis.
03
Data Engineers: Data engineers develop and maintain the infrastructure required for data storage and processing. They need data documentation to understand the data sources, data transformations, and any specific technical details that may be relevant to their work.
In summary, filling out a data documentation requires gathering information, creating a structured format, providing detailed descriptions for data sources and elements, documenting quality standards and transformations, and including any necessary references. Data analysts, data scientists, and data engineers are the primary users who benefit from having accurate and comprehensive data documentation.
